Ingredient Breakdown
Let’s get into the nitty-gritty of what you’ll need for this incredible dish:
- 8 large eggs: The base of our bake, providing protein and structure.
- 1 cup spinach, chopped: A great way to sneak in some greens!
- 1 bell pepper, diced: Adds a sweet crunch.
- 1 cup mushrooms, sliced: Earthy and hearty, these add depth to the flavor.
- 1/2 cup onion, diced: For that aromatic base.
- 1/2 cup cherry tomatoes, halved: Juicy bursts of flavor.
- 1 cup cottage cheese: Creamy goodness that binds everything together.
- 1 cup shredded cheese (cheddar or your choice): Because cheese makes everything better!
- 1 teaspoon garlic powder: A must for that aromatic kick.
- 1 teaspoon salt: To enhance all those flavors.
- 1/2 teaspoon black pepper: A little heat goes a long way.
- 1 tablespoon olive oil: For sautéing the veggies.
**Substitutions:** You can easily swap out ingredients based on what you have. Try using zucchini instead of bell pepper, or switch cottage cheese for ricotta for a creamier texture!

No-Boil Pasta Bake
Ingredients
Method
-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C).
- Sauté onions, bell peppers, and mushrooms in olive oil until soft, 5 minutes.
- Add spinach and cherry tomatoes; cook until spinach wilts, 2 minutes.
- Mix eggs, cottage cheese, garlic powder, salt, and pepper; fold in vegetables.
- Pour into a greased baking dish, top with shredded cheese, and bake 30-35 minutes.
